Darian Voss never authorized the Red Edition.That hasn't stopped everyone from wanting one.When mysterious crimson copies of Darian's first novel begin appearing at underground auctions and private collections, scarcity transforms them into the most coveted books on Earth. Collectors offer fortunes. Readers become dangerously obsessed. Bookstores descend into chaos. Every attempt by Voss House to recall the unauthorized editions only drives their value-and Darian's rapidly expanding publishing empire-higher.Investigative journalist Lena Orrow discovers something far more disturbing than counterfeiting. Readers report missing time, compulsive rereading, synchronized dreams of an impossible city, and creatures moving between printed letters. Beneath magnification, Darian encounters Syrakai, an elegant insectile Veyrathi capable of inhabiting the spaces within written language. The creature reveals that ordinary Dryackmine was merely the beginning. The concentrated phenomenon known as Redwake can make human minds increasingly receptive to something waiting beyond the page.As corporations, investors, retailers, and desperate collectors turn supernatural horror into opportunity, Darian confronts an unbearable truth: nobody ever commanded him to expand.They simply made expansion profitable.And when Lena uncovers records spanning generations of publishers, she discovers Voss House has entered a competition that began long before Darian was born.
